French bulldogs make an excellent pet for those living in cities or have small outdoor space. They are small in size and require only moderate exercise, which can typically be met through their normal indoor activities as well as short walks on a daily basis.
They also have a low maintenance grooming requirement that require only regular brushing and attention to their inherited wrinkles. They are also easy to train.

Before buying a French Bulldog it is important to understand the requirements of the breed. These dogs require regular grooming and cleaning. They also need to be kept warm when it's cold outside. It's also crucial to keep them out of hot or humid places, as they can be prone to heat strokes.
It is recommended to purchase a Frenchie from an established breeder. This will ensure that the puppy has been well-socialized and is healthy. The puppy will also be given the most recent vaccinations and will be guaranteed health. You should also make sure that your home is puppy-proofed to avoid accidents from happening.
As a breed that thrives on human attention, it's important to socialize your new puppy as early as possible. This will aid in their development into a well-mannered and confident adult. It's important to bring your Frenchie regularly for check-ups at the vet and to get shots. Keeping up with these appointments can help you to avoid serious health issues later on.
Frenchies require daily exercise to stay healthy and active. They also tend to snore and drool and snore, so it's crucial to wash their wrinkles frequently. Additionally, because they are brachycephalic, they aren't able to cool themselves as quickly as other dogs and can become overheated quickly.

You should teach him the basic obedience commands the same way you would any other puppy. Start with "sit," which is the easiest command to master and serves as a base for all other commands. Once you've learned that you can progress to more advanced tricks and obedience exercises. Be gentle with your puppy and employ positive reinforcement during training sessions.
While Frenchies are playful with their owners, they can't endure prolonged periods of hard play or intense exercise. This can cause breathing problems and heat stress. To avoid this you must be aware of any playtime with your French Bulldog.
